Open WebUI让AI工具调用像对话一样自然的智能平台【免费下载链接】open-webuiUser-friendly AI Interface (Supports Ollama, OpenAI API, ...)项目地址: https://gitcode.com/GitHub_Trending/op/open-webui你是否曾遇到过这样的困扰面对一个功能强大的AI助手却不知道如何准确表达需求或者需要记忆复杂的命令格式才能调用特定功能这正是传统AI交互界面给用户带来的挑战。Open WebUI的出现彻底改变了这一局面——它让AI工具调用变得像日常对话一样自然流畅。从复杂指令到自然语言AI交互的革命性转变想象一下你不再需要记住调用天气API参数为城市名这样的技术指令而是可以直接说明天北京天气怎么样Open WebUI能够理解你的自然语言自动识别意图并调用相应的天气查询工具。这种转变的背后是智能模式匹配技术的深度应用。上图展示了Open WebUI的直观界面左侧是清晰的功能导航右侧是简洁的对话区域。系统能够根据你的输入内容智能推荐相关工具和功能就像一位贴心的助手在旁随时准备提供帮助。智能工具匹配如何让AI听懂你的需求Open WebUI的核心优势在于其智能工具匹配系统。当用户输入查询时系统会进行多层次的分析意图识别分析语句的核心目的和上下文参数提取自动提取所需的关键信息工具选择从工具库中匹配最适合的功能模块执行优化确保调用过程高效准确这个过程的实现依赖于项目中的多个核心模块。例如工具数据模型定义在backend/open_webui/models/tools.py中它定义了工具的基本结构和属性。而路由处理逻辑则在backend/open_webui/routers/tools.py中实现负责处理具体的工具调用请求。实际应用从理论到实践的完美转化让我们通过几个实际场景来看看Open WebUI如何改变工作方式场景一数据分析变得简单传统方式你需要编写复杂的SQL查询或Python脚本 Open WebUI方式只需说帮我分析上个月的销售数据趋势系统会自动调用数据分析工具生成可视化报告场景二代码开发效率倍增传统方式需要手动查找API文档、编写测试代码 Open WebUI方式输入创建一个用户注册的REST API接口系统会生成完整的代码框架包括错误处理和验证逻辑场景三文档处理智能化传统方式手动整理、分类、总结文档内容 Open WebUI方式上传文档后说提取关键要点并生成摘要系统会自动处理并呈现结构化结果技术架构优雅而强大的设计哲学Open WebUI的技术架构体现了简单但不简化的设计理念。前端与后端的协作通过精心设计的API接口实现如src/lib/apis/tools/index.ts中展示的各种工具管理函数包括创建、更新、删除和权限控制等完整功能。这种架构的优势在于模块化设计每个工具都是独立的模块易于维护和扩展权限精细控制支持用户级、组级的多层次访问控制实时响应基于现代Web技术栈提供流畅的用户体验开放扩展支持自定义工具开发满足个性化需求就像探索宇宙需要先进的工具一样Open WebUI为AI交互提供了强大的技术支撑。这张星云图片象征着技术创新的无限可能性——每个工具都像是宇宙中的一颗星星共同构成了强大的AI生态系统。用户体验从工具使用者到创意实现者Open WebUI最引人注目的特点之一是它如何重新定义用户与AI的关系。用户不再是被动接受技术服务的消费者而是变成了创意实现的主导者。这种转变体现在几个关键方面降低技术门槛无论你是技术专家还是普通用户都能通过自然语言与AI进行有效沟通。系统会自动处理技术细节让你专注于核心需求。提升创作自由有了智能工具调用的支持你可以更自由地探索各种可能性。想尝试新的数据分析方法只需描述你的想法系统会推荐合适的工具组合。加速学习曲线通过观察系统如何响应你的需求你实际上在学习如何更有效地与AI协作。这种学习是潜移默化的却效果显著。未来展望AI工具调用的进化方向随着技术的不断发展Open WebUI的智能工具调用功能也在持续进化。我们可以预见几个重要趋势上下文理解深化系统将更好地理解对话历史和环境上下文多模态交互增强支持图像、语音、文本的混合输入和处理个性化适配优化根据用户习惯和偏好自动调整工具推荐策略协作能力提升支持多用户协同使用同一组工具米开朗基罗的《创造亚当》描绘了神圣的接触瞬间。在某种程度上Open WebUI也在创造类似的连接——不是神与人而是人与技术之间的无缝对接。这张艺术杰作提醒我们最好的技术应该像那只伸出的手一样自然、有力且充满可能性。开始你的智能AI之旅要体验Open WebUI的强大功能你可以通过以下步骤快速开始环境准备确保系统满足基本运行要求项目获取克隆仓库到本地环境配置部署按照文档完成初始设置工具探索从内置工具开始逐步尝试自定义功能Open WebUI不仅仅是一个工具调用平台它代表了一种全新的AI交互范式。在这里技术复杂性被隐藏起来创意表达得到最大程度的释放。无论你是开发者、研究者还是普通用户都能在这个平台上找到属于自己的AI协作方式。记住最好的技术是那些让你几乎感觉不到其存在的技术。Open WebUI正是这样的存在——它默默地在后台工作让你专注于真正重要的事情创造、思考和解决问题。现在是时候开始你的智能AI交互体验了。【免费下载链接】open-webuiUser-friendly AI Interface (Supports Ollama, OpenAI API, ...)项目地址: https://gitcode.com/GitHub_Trending/op/open-webui创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考